Compound adjectives The little old lady hit the tall and distinguished gentleman. Predicate adjective. Back to Sentence Diagramming Index Appositive Phrases Appositives are nouns that rename other nouns.

Appositive phrases consist of an appositive and the appositive’s modifiers. Mike and Bri graduated from UWEC, my alma mater.

A prepositional phrase is a group of words that begins with a preposition and ends with a noun or a pronoun. The whole phrase functions as either an adjective or an adverb.
